About

CARBORUNIV.NSE refers to the stock of Carborundum Universal Limited, traded on the National Stock Exchange of India (NSE). Carborundum Universal is a leading Indian manufacturer of abrasives, ceramics, refractories, and electro minerals. The ".NSE" extension indicates that the trading and price information pertains specifically to its listing on the National Stock Exchange. Investors and market participants use this symbol to track the company's performance, analyze its stock price movements, and execute trades on the NSE platform. The company's financial performance and overall market conditions influence the price of CARBORUNIV.NSE.

Factors

Company Performance: Carborundum Universal's financial health, including revenue growth, profitability, and debt levels, significantly influences its stock price. Strong earnings typically lead to higher stock valuation.

Industry Trends: The performance of the abrasives and industrial ceramics sectors, where Carborundum Universal operates, impacts investor sentiment. Positive industry outlooks can drive up demand for its stock.

Economic Conditions: Macroeconomic factors like GDP growth, inflation, and interest rates affect overall market sentiment and can influence investors' decisions regarding Carborundum Universal's stock.

Global Events: International events, such as trade wars, geopolitical tensions, and global economic downturns, can impact global markets and affect Carborundum Universal's stock price.

Investor Sentiment: Market psychology and investor confidence play a crucial role. Positive news and optimistic forecasts can lead to increased buying pressure, driving the stock price up.

Regulatory Changes: Government regulations and policies related to the manufacturing or export of Carborundum Universal's products can have an impact on its profitability and, consequently, its stock price.

Raw Material Prices: Fluctuations in the prices of raw materials used in the production of abrasives and ceramics can affect Carborundum Universal's profit margins and influence its stock price.

Competition: The competitive landscape and market share of Carborundum Universal in the abrasives industry can affect its growth prospects and investor confidence, thereby influencing its stock price.
